What are the common problems with garage doors in Sacramento?

Common garage door problems in Sacramento often include issues with the springs, which can weaken or break due to frequent use and temperature fluctuations. Malfunctioning garage door openers, whether due to electrical issues, remote problems, or worn internal parts, are also frequent. Damaged panels, bent tracks, and worn-out rollers can lead to noisy operation and difficulty opening or closing the door. What makes modern garage doors different?

Modern garage doors often feature sleek designs, advanced materials, and integrated smart technology. Unlike traditional wooden doors, many modern options utilize materials like steel, aluminum, or composite for increased durability and lower maintenance. They frequently incorporate insulated panels for better energy efficiency and can be equipped with advanced opener systems that allow for smartphone control and monitoring. What is involved in installing a LiftMaster garage door opener?

Installing a LiftMaster garage door opener involves securely mounting the motor unit, typically to the ceiling, and connecting it to the garage door via a rail and trolley mechanism. This process includes setting the opener's travel limits and force settings to ensure the door operates smoothly and safely. Safety sensors must be correctly positioned at the bottom of the door tracks to detect obstructions. What is the typical cost for garage door spring repair?

The cost for garage door spring repair is primarily determined by the type of springs—torsion springs mounted above the door or extension springs along the tracks—and their specific dimensions. Torsion springs are generally more expensive due to their design and mounting location. The complexity of the repair, which involves handling high-tension components safely, also influences the price. What is a wall mount garage door opener and its benefits?

A wall mount garage door opener, also known as a jackshaft opener, is mounted directly to the torsion spring shaft on the side of the garage door. This design frees up overhead space, making it ideal for garages with low ceilings or obstructions like storage shelves. Wall mount openers are generally quieter and more compact than traditional overhead openers. What is a garage door screen and how does it function?

A garage door screen is a mesh barrier that can be installed on the opening of your garage door, effectively transforming your garage into an additional, well-ventilated living space. When the main garage door is open, the screen can be deployed to keep insects, debris, and pests out while allowing fresh air to circulate. These screens are typically made from durable materials like fiberglass or aluminum mesh and can be either retractable or permanent fixtures.
